API Staging Is Not Production - But Speedscale Makes It Close

Staging environments are often looked at as the testing ground ahead of the “real” production environment. The idea is simple – build a duplicate of your production environment, run your tests, and ship with confidence. But the reality of using staging in the real world as part of a holistic API testing strategy is rarely that clean. No matter how meticulously you mirror production services, staging always falls a little short.

Docker Layer Caching: Speed Up CI/CD Builds

Docker layer caching (DLC) is a powerful technique that can significantly accelerate your CI/CD pipelines. By reusing unchanged image layers across builds, DLC not only cuts down on build times but also reduces cloud costs and boosts developer productivity. In this article, we’ll break down how Docker layer caching works, how to implement it effectively, and how to combine it with ephemeral environments for maximum impact.

Undo a Git Commit - Without Losing Your Code

Think you have to reset hard or revert every time you mess up a Git commit? Nope. In this episode of Wait… Git Can Do That?, we show you how to undo your last commit without losing any changes — using git reset --soft HEAD~1.
